I think the answer is pretty simple. Personally, I would never buy a vehicle that has frame damage and here's why. Anything can be fixed, but what it comes down to is how good of a fix you are going to get. I am sure there are collision shops out there that will do their best to fix a bent frame, but the slightest oversight can effect how your car can potentially drive. I would not want my alignment to be constantly messed up, effecting my tires, etc..... Comes down to if you want to deal with headaches that might be associated with a bent frame and if the savings can really justify the potential problems that you might encounter.
